Mobility of Negative Ions in SuperfluidHe3

Abstract
We have found that the mobility of negative ions increases rapidly below Tc in both superfluid He3 phases. The ratio μμN of superfluid to normal mobility is larger in the B phase than in the A phase. A critical velocity consistent in magnitude with the Landau limit for pair breaking has also been observed. In the normal fluid we find a temperature-independent mobility between 30 mK and Tc for all pressures between 0 and 28 bars.
